TL;DR Summary

House Speaker Kevin McCarthy quickly backtracked after suggesting in a CNBC interview that former President Donald Trump might not be the strongest candidate to beat President Biden in the 2024 election. McCarthy's comments angered Trump's allies, prompting him to offer an exclusive interview to Breitbart News in which he declared Trump the "strongest political opponent" against Biden. McCarthy's attempt to ingratiate himself to Trump reflects his fear of alienating the former president as he struggles to keep together his fractious House majority and withstand mounting pressure from right-wing lawmakers loyal to Trump.
